2016 Wind Gap Wines Pinot Noir - USA, California, Sonoma County, Sonoma Coast (11/4/2018)
Very well put together, young Pinot Noir, with cherry fruit accented by licorice and cinnamon spice tones. There is a sneaky tannic structure, which bodes well for future development. I am sorry to see this bottling disappear, as Pax Mahle exits Wind Gap, but it’s a nice swan song.
